William Joel Masters (born March 15, 1944) is an American former professional football player who was a tight end in the American Football League (AFL) for the Buffalo Bills (1967–1969) and in the National Football League (NFL) for the Denver Broncos (1970–1974) and the Kansas City Chiefs (1975–1976). Masters played college football for the LSU Tigers in Baton Rouge, Louisiana.[1]
